For the last two decades, geosynthetic-reinforced soil retaining walls (GRS RWs) with a
stage-constructed full-height rigid (FHR) facing have been constructed for railways, highways and
other facilities and have shown greater seismic resistance than conventional retaining wall structures
(Tatsuoka et al., 2009). Geogrids are commonly used as planar reinforcements to tensile-reinforce the
backfill of RWs, embankments and other soil structures.
